Analyze and Predict the Co‐movement Effect of Risks in the Supply Chain Management

並列摘要


Supply chain includes a lot of channel members. Because of outsourcing, lean manufacturing, just‐in‐time (JIT) inventory, globalization and other factors, supply chain is becoming more complex and the number and scope of supply chain risk factors are significantly increasing. When risk emerges, there may be crises in the entire supply chain. This paper identifies risk factors and explores supply chain risk management issues reported in the Wall Street Journal. We apply association rules to find out the risks which may be co‐incidental and failure mode and effect analysis (FMEA) to identify all possible failure. Then, we develop event relative data simulation (ERDS) to simulate 5000 records of transactions data. From observing the risk rules and simulation data, we can predict and propose implications for the managers that can serve as a reference in decision-making.
